Ezhou Huahu Airport Launches Direct Athens Flight to Enhance Chinaeurope Trade

Ezhou Huahu Airport Launches Direct Athens Flight to Enhance Chinaeurope Trade

Ezhou Huahu Airport launched its first new route of 2026, "Ezhou=Athens", with two flights per week and an annual capacity of 20,000 tons. The route primarily transports cross-border e-commerce goods and Greek specialties. This move is a significant step for Huahu Airport in optimizing its European route network and supporting the "Belt and Road" initiative. In 2025, Huahu Airport experienced substantial growth in cargo volume. The airport will continue to promote its hub enhancement strategy to build a world-class air cargo hub.

US Services Sector Shows Resilience Despite September Slowdown

US Services Sector Shows Resilience Despite September Slowdown

The US ISM Non-Manufacturing Index edged down to 54.4 in September, slightly below the previous reading but still above the expansionary threshold of 50, indicating continued growth in the non-manufacturing sector. Sub-indexes such as business activity, new orders, and employment all experienced declines, reflecting economic challenges. However, the overall sector remains robust. Attention should be paid to the impact of Federal Reserve policies and economic structural transformation on the non-manufacturing sector.

US Services Sector Growth Slows but Remains Strong in September

US Services Sector Growth Slows but Remains Strong in September

The U.S. ISM Non-Manufacturing Index (NMI) registered 58.6 in September, according to the Institute for Supply Management. While slightly lower than August, the NMI remains well above the 50 threshold, indicating continued expansion in the non-manufacturing sector. This sector has now experienced growth for 56 consecutive months, providing significant support to the U.S. economy.
